Output 76d885849af13a121d668568de3ef8631e59d5d1a70d732c3538b8b2ceabdf6e:0

value
43540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2683ed23fd7904f22c6889a9aff595fbf3572a41 OP_EQUAL
address
35CfeEcHmzZ83EPPGKFj5PZ4HbRbLJLeYH
transaction
76d885849af13a121d668568de3ef8631e59d5d1a70d732c3538b8b2ceabdf6e
spent
true